TWENTY-FIVE
Screams woke him up. Loud screams. They pierced the air making it appear to vibrate all around him, making it impossible to see anything in the deep, dark mist shrouding his existence. The terrifying shouts were filled with such pain and anguish it sounded like a mortal soul had shattered into dust. Who was screaming? Stop it! Stop it! He clutched at the blankets, holding on for dear life, trying to get the terrifying sounds to go away. âNo!â he shouted.
Then he realized the screams had come from him as he came further awake, the nightmare slowly losing its grip on him. Another night terror. This one worse than the last. Heâd relived his own death again. The darkness and evil lurking on the other side awaited him with a finality that doomed him to never-ending pain. There would be no redemption for him. No coming back from what he had done.
Was it his fault heâd been born this way? He loved children too much, maybe that was the problem. Did that make him a bad man? One past redemption? He knew it to be true now, ever since heâd consented to Last Call. There would be no forgiveness for him. No washing away of his sins. They had all lied to him. Said it could be done. That God forgave all.
His sin had been judged to be too dark, too evil for him to escape final judgment. Life was now impossible, knowing what awaited him.
A nurse came rushing into the room, her expression equal parts exasperated and concerned. His night terrors were happening more frequently. At least once every hour he was awakened by screaming, his own. There would never be any relief for him. He would end it all if only he wasnât going straight to hell to live among them. The damned.
âAre you in any pain?â the nurse he knew as Jackie asked, her forehead creased into a frown.
He could only stare at her with disbelief. How could she not see it? His evil was leaching out of him, an oily black tar substance sticking to everything he touched or looked at. Even now some of it dripped from her chin, making her appear ghoulish. He blinked the image away. Itâs not real, he tried to comfort himself. But the idea persisted. Was she one of them? A collaborator with Satanâs army?
All he knew for certain was he could never die. Not with what waited him on the other side. But he was living in a century when it had yet to happen. Immortality. If only heâd been born in the future. Maybe if he hung on long enough, a breakthrough would happen? A faint hope at best, but he needed something to soothe him, to keep him from going mad.
âIâll give you something to sleep,â she said.
âNo!â The last thing he wanted was to relive the nightmare again. The black maws of death, the sharp pinchers tearing at his skin, the fierce fire singing away all his hair.
